Exports In 2023, Zambia exported $2.26M in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ites), making it the 57th largest exporter of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) in the world. At the same year,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) was the 134th most exported product in Zambia. The main destination of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) exports from Zambia are: Democratic Republic of the Congo ($2.26M) and Tanzania ($777).

The fastest growing export markets for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) of Zambia between 2022 and 2023 were Democratic Republic of the Congo ($2.25M).

Imports In 2023, Zambia imported $10.9M in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ites), becoming the 65th largest importer of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) in the world. At the same year,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) was the 149th most imported product in Zambia. Zambia imports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) primarily from: China ($7.45M), South Africa ($3.01M), United Arab Emirates ($138k), Turkey ($112k), and India ($93.7k).

The fastest growing import markets in Phosphinates (hypophosphites) and phosphonates (phosphites) for Zambia between 2022 and 2023 were China ($4.88M), Turkey ($112k), and India ($55.8k).
